首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ql删除数据库表失败

MySQL是一种常用的关系型数据库管理系统,用于存储和管理大量结构化数据。在进行数据库操作时,可能会遇到删除数据库表失败的情况。以下是完善且全面的答案:

概念: MySQL删除数据库表失败是指在执行删除数据库表的操作时,MySQL服务器返回一个错误,导致删除操作无法成功完成。

分类: MySQL删除数据库表失败的错误可以分为以下几类:

  1. 权限错误:当前用户没有足够的权限执行删除操作。
  2. 表不存在:尝试删除的表在数据库中不存在。
  3. 外键约束:存在其他表与要删除的表存在外键约束,导致删除操作失败。
  4. 正在被使用:要删除的表正在被其他进程或连接使用,导致删除操作失败。
  5. 其他错误:如连接中断、表被锁等。

优势: MySQL删除数据库表失败的错误是系统及时检测到删除操作存在问题,以避免误删除和数据丢失的风险。通过错误信息,可以快速定位问题并进行修复。

应用场景: MySQL删除数据库表失败的错误可能在以下场景中出现:

  1. 开发环境:在进行开发调试时,可能由于代码错误或操作不当导致删除操作失败。
  2. 生产环境:在生产环境中,由于系统复杂性和多用户访问等原因,删除操作失败的风险较大。

推荐的腾讯云相关产品: 腾讯云提供了多个与MySQL相关的产品和服务,可以帮助解决MySQL删除数据库表失败的问题,例如:

  1. 云数据库MySQL:腾讯云提供的高性能、可扩展的云数据库服务,可以实现自动备份、故障恢复等功能,避免删除操作失败导致的数据丢失。
  2. 数据库审计:腾讯云的数据库审计服务可以实时监控和记录数据库的操作日志,帮助快速定位和修复删除操作失败的问题。
  3. 数据库备份与恢复:腾讯云提供的数据库备份和恢复服务可以定期备份数据库,并在删除操作失败后进行恢复,保证数据的安全性和可靠性。

产品介绍链接地址:

  1. 云数据库MySQL:https://cloud.tencent.com/product/cdb
  2. 数据库审计:https://cloud.tencent.com/product/das
  3. 数据库备份与恢复:https://cloud.tencent.com/product/snapshot
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券